As modern power grids integrate increasing levels of renewable energy and face stricter reliability standards, the choice of simulation software becomes critical. This paper explores the technical strengths of Siemens PSS/E, focusing on its scalability, established legacy, and automation capabilities that distinguish it from competitors like DIgSILENT PowerFactory or ETAP in the transmission sector.
